General Comment

USFWS oversight of federal agencies ensures compliance with the Endangered
Species Act, especially in cases where federal agency personnel do not have the
time or experience to research and determine if a proposed act will emperil the
population or viability of habitat of the given species.

This is a flawed regulation. The current ESA with USFWS consultation requirement
must stand. Not only do the species in question that currently have or are
waiting (interminably so) for protection under the ESA need the current agency
consultation with USFWS, but the future of the human species depends on it.

This proposed regulation must not be passed.
